The Narrative Of A Journey Undertaken In 1819-1821: Through France, Italy, Savoy, Switzerland (1834) is a travelogue written by James Holman. The book details the author's journey through various European countries during the early 19th century. Holman, who was blind, embarked on this journey to explore the world and challenge the limitations imposed upon him by his disability.
